                2025 Fantasy Outlook
                
                    Although he remains one of the NFL's best passing-down backs, White's gliding, passive style of running between the tackles made him vulnerable last season once Bucky Irving offered a contrasting, compelling alternative. Irving runs with zero hesitation and maximum aggression, whereas White seems to cautiously tread in comparison, as if waiting for a crease that never appears. Indeed, White is clearly more comfortable in space than in traffic, and as long as that's the case, it will be difficult for him to take a lot of touches at Irving's expense. The appeal for fantasy is that White's passing-down skills and strong track record of durability could lead to huge workloads if Irving misses time. Even then, there's some chance Sean Tucker -- who averaged 6.2 YPC on 50 carries last year -- would siphon off a meaningful share of early down work, leaving White with fewer touches than what a healthy Irving normally would handle.             Lesser of tandem backfield Sunday
White rushed 13 times for 35 yards and had two receptions on as many targets for 26 yards in Sunday's 23-3 win over the Saints.
				ANALYSIS
White got another start in place of injured starter Bucky Irving (foot/shoulder) in Week 8, leading the Buccaneers' backfield in carries (13) and touches (15) in a comfortable win. That's where the good news ends, as backfield mate Sean Tucker (12-42-1) finished as the team's leading rusher while scoring its only touchdown on offense Sunday. With the Buccaneers on a bye in Week 9, there is a possibility that Irving could be ready to return when Tampa Bay resumes play against New England on Nov. 9. White would lose nearly all of his fantasy value in that scenario, so managers have to weigh whether it is worth holding on to the backup through the bye week.

		            Offense was a surprising bright spot for the Buccaneers in 2023, and White played a big role in that outcome. The 2022 third-round pick really settled in as a workhorse for Tampa Bay, taking a much bigger workload than he'd ever previously handled in the NFL or college. White held up well in the new role, playing 17 games and leading all RBs with 823 snaps. He was particularly effective as a pass catcher, turning 70 targets into 64 catches for 549 yards and three touchdowns. That's elite efficiency by RB standards, and to an extent that can't happen based on luck alone over such a considerable sample. The catch is that White's rushing production was predictably inefficient behind an O-line that had three new starters and struggled on the interior, with his rushing average of 3.6 yards opening up the possibility of another RB getting in on the action in 2024. Good as White was in 2023 -- especially for fantasy purposes -- it's also true that his volume was granted in part because the Bucs had little else in the backfield. The addition of fourth-round pick Bucky Irving is a slight concern at a glance because the rookie is also a capable pass catcher, but White has size, speed and experience working in his favor (Irving ran a 4.55 40 at 5-9, 192, compared to White's 4.48 at 6-0, 214). With Irving and Chase Edmonds the main threats to take playing time, White could rank among the league leaders in snaps and touches again.

    Run atop depth chart continues
White is expected to remain Tampa Bay's starting running back for Week 8 against the Saints, as head coach Todd Bowles said Wednesday that Bucky Irving will miss a fourth consecutive game due to a foot injury, Greg Auman of Fox Sports reports.
				ANALYSIS
White has averaged 17.3 touches per game during the first three weeks of Irving's absence while scoring three touchdowns over that span. With Tampa Bay on bye in Week 9, White could see a heavy Week 8 workload against the 1-6 Saints.
